AIM has risen by one-third over the past 12 months and the FTSE 100 index is one fifth higher. However, the FTSE Fledgling index has increased by 53.3% over the same period.
The Fledgling index has much smaller companies than AIM. It certainly does not have the likes of ASOS and Boohoo, which dominate the performance of AIM because of their large weightings in each of the main indexes.
